Munching on a wampi
Wampi are unusual looking fruit, a little like lychees but with a smooth almost papery skin which pops open to reveal the juicy grape like flesh inside. We have just planted a wampi tree in our backyard, and I’m munching on some fruit at the moment – not from our tree, a few years before that happens but I discovered some at the local markets. Quite tasty, although I think will taste heaps better straight off the tree.

Fruit trees
Great timing with all the rain we’ve had lately; we’ve been planting fruit trees.
We have several varieties of citrus including tangerine, orange, mandarine, lemon and lime. We have several different varieties of tropical fruits including mango, chocolate pudding tree (black sapote), white sapote, abiu – a caramel flavoured fruit, tropical peach, tropical pear, and barbados cherry. We have an avocado, a green olive, several coffee plants and a couple of passionfruit vines.
